Investment Objective
Total return with an emphasis on providing current income.
Strategy
Under normal market conditions, the Fund invests at least 80% of its total net assets in income-paying publicly traded common stocks, preferred stocks, and other equity-related instruments of companies located in the Asia region, which includes China, Hong Kong, India, Indonesia, Japan, Malaysia, Pakistan, Philippines, Singapore, South Korea, Sri Lanka, Taiwan, Thailand and Vietnam.

Risks
Investments in Asian securities may involve risks such as social and political instability, market illiquidity, exchange-rate fluctuations, a high level of volatility and limited regulation.
